1) Hardness. Hardness is one of the most commonly used material properties, and can be applied to any solid material. It refers to the ability of a material to withstand scratching or indenting on its surface. Obviously, harder materials are more difficult to scratch or dent.

Difference Between Hardness and Toughness | Compare the ...

2015-10-19· For a solid material, hardness and toughness values depend on the elasticity, plasticity and fraction. The key difference between hardness and toughness is that these two properties of materials have an inverse relationship. For a particular solid material; as hardness increases, toughness decreases.

Tungsten Metal (W) Element Chemical + Physical Properties

Tungsten is a greyish-white lustrous metal, which is a solid at room temperature. Tungsten has the highest melting point and lowest vapor pressure of all metals, and at temperatures over 1650°C has the highest tensile strength. 4.1 Properties of Materials | Design Technology

Hardness. The resistance a material offers to penetration or scratching. Design contexts include ceramic floor tiles that extremely hard and resistant to scratching. Mechanical properties. Tensile strength. The ability of a material to withstand pulling (apart) forces. It is important in selecting materials to resist stretching. Metal Properties: Hardness, Toughness, & Strength ...

2015-10-05· Hardness: A material's ability to withstand friction, essentially abrasion resistance, is known as hardness. Diamonds are among the hardest substances known to man, it is incredibly difficult to scratch a diamond. However, while a diamond is hard it is not tough.
